Had a couple questions on taking WitchHunters as allies.

 

First, several Adeptas Sororitas units allow an Immolator to be taken as a transport. The codex calls these Transports, not Dedicated Transports as the newer codecii do. If I take a valid non-Heavy Support unit as an ally (I'm thinking of building a Templars+Sisters army), can I also take their Transport Immolator? Is such a selection a Dedicated Transport for a unit, or not?

 

Also, the Witch Hunters codex allows Priests to be taken as HQ choices that don't count toward FOC slots. I am assuming that if you take a Priest as an ally, it still does not take up the 0-1 HQ selection for the allied Witch Hunters' FOC, correct? Since these Priests must always be attached to a unit, can I attach them to my Core Army units? For example, I thought about adding them to a Black Templar Crusader squad, or perhaps a Templars Terminator squad. Can this be done legally, or must the Priest be added to a Witch Hunters unit?

Here's a more concreteexample of the Immolator question:

 

Start with a Core army of Black Templars. Select a Dominion squad as an allied Witch Hunters unit. This is a Fast Attack squad. Dominions MUST select a transport. If the unit is 6 models or less, you can select an Immolator as their transport. Is this Immolator selected as a dedicated transport, or as a Heavy Support slot? I would claim it is a Dedicated Transport, much like you can select a unit of Space marine Terminators and give them a Land Raider as a dedicated transport.

Yes, an Immolator (or Rhino) taken as a transport for a WH unit is considered a dedicated transport for that unit, and as of the current WH FAQ you will be using the current rules for dedicated transports found in the BRB (unlike DH dedicated transports).

 

As to Priests, they must be attached to specific units from their own codex and are counted as a unit upgrade to the units they are attached to (i.e., they do not have the Independent Charater rule). There shouldn't be any reason why you could not take WH Priests with WH units that are being allied into a Marine parent list, as long as they are attached to the correct units and that those units are available to be allied.
